South Western Ontario Sharks Swim League finals held in Milverton
The Perth East Recreation Complex pool in Milverton was a busy spot for the South Western Ontario Sharks Swim League finals on Aug. 5, with several local swim teams taking part in their season-ending event. The Atwood Lions Club and T&T Power Group provided tech sponsorship for the event.

Gowanstown track athlete double-medals at Ontario Summer Games
Gowanstown’s Kennedy Brooks was a double medalist at the Ontario Summer Games in Mississauga on July 21-24, picking up gold in the 4x100 metre relay and bronze in the 80m sprint. Other local track and field competitors included Hudson and Addison Imrie.
